簡體   English   中英

如何在相互依賴的Netbeans中處理兩個項目

[英]How to work with two projects in Netbeans that depend on each other

我有兩個項目:

main_project-它是用Eclipse編寫的,具有所有后端

gui_project-我正在Swing的main_project前端(在Netbeans中)

兩者都有Maven Pom:

main_project:

<groupId>com.group</groupId>
<artifactId>main_project</artifactId>
<version>0.0.1-SNAPSHOT</version>
<packaging>jar</packaging>
<name>MainProject</name>

gui_project:

<groupId>com.group</groupId>
<artifactId>gui_project</artifactId>
<version>1.0-SNAPSHOT</version>
<packaging>jar</packaging>
<name>GUI</name>

現在,我想在gui_project(兩者在Netbeans的工作區)使用類從main_project,但我不能讓gui_project看到main_project。

我也在gui_project中添加了依賴項:

   <dependency>
        <groupId>org.group</groupId>
        <artifactId>main_project</artifactId>
        <version>0.0.1-SNAPSHOT</version>
    </dependency>

解決了

清理和構建有幫助(項目>清理和構建上的鼠標右鍵)。

感謝assylias

清理和構建有幫助(項目>清理和構建上的鼠標右鍵)。

感謝assylias

IDE本身應該立即知道項目之間的鏈接,這意味着gui-project中的Java代碼中沒有錯誤。 但是,在事物的專家方面,必須遵循專家自己的規則。 這意味着如果不在同一反應堆中構建2個項目(例如,通過構建包含兩個項目作為參考的pom項目),則需要在本地存儲庫中用工件表示。 因此,可以預先構建,也可以從遠程(快照)存儲庫下載。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M